Output 46006697519df676b1199541e976c3af0d40c2903bfe32ee19c288fba649839f:92

value
2665459
script pubkey
OP_0 OP_PUSHBYTES_20 9424156ab9ee60cd5b717c19503abe787bbf54c9
address
bc1qjsjp264eaesv6km30sv4qw470pam74xf7eneqw
transaction
46006697519df676b1199541e976c3af0d40c2903bfe32ee19c288fba649839f